Selling Tips

Do Simple Jobs
Are you trying to sell property in newent? If so, you may want to take a good, objective look around. How many small, simple jobs are there that you haven't bothered getting around to doing? The problem is that we become blind to the small flaws after a while (apart from the ones that annoy us), whereas an observant newcomer to your home will spot them straight away. We're talking about curling wall-paper, or borders just need sticking down; Marks on walls, that need wiping off; Dead flies or dust on a lamp-shade; Dirty windows; Old screw-holes in walls that need filling and touching up. Now is the time to put a day aside to do these little jobs, and help achieve the best price for you property.

Cats And Dogs in your garden.
If you're selling property in newent then you may want to check your garden for mess left behind by either your pets or neighbour's pets. If your garden looks like it's being used as a toilet, then this can make a very bad impression. Clean up after your own pets, and consider installing anti dog / cat measures to scare away / deter neighbour's pets. Please ensure these devices are humane.
Neutralise Nasty Odours
If you're trying to sell your newent property, then perhaps it's time to ask a good friend the question "does my house smell". If you live with unpleasant odours, then you may no longer notice them. Get the blunt opinion of a friend. If there's a problem, don't worry... there are plenty of products on the market to remove nasty smells, rather than cover them up.

Low Transaction Volumes
The land registry have reported that from the month November
2008 to the month February 2009, transactions have averaged 31,315 per month. This being a decrease of over 50% from the same period last year, when sales volumes averaged 75,374! Never mind. Keep smiling, the housing market will pick up again at some point.
Buy And Refurbish In A Risky Market
I speculate just how many people got caught badly in the slump in the market, when they bought a property at what looked like a bargain price, spent thousands of pounds doing it up, in the vain dream of selling it on at a return. Very many, I'm sure! The question is... is there still money to be made? How can the risk be minimized? When you recognize a prospective home, go bring a newent estate agent, or a few, and find an specialist opinion. How much is the home genuinely worth at present? How much will it be worth if it was made up to a first-rate standard? Find a builder who is used to subbing out the many aspects of the renovation trade, and get a reasonable quotation for the overhaul work. Now work out your possible revenue, and measure how gravely the market would need to downturn to wipe out that turnover, and land you in debt. Now you should have a realistic assessment of the risk. Don't forget... it's easy to start going in excess of budget on the overhaul. Make allowances for this! These are just a number of suggestions... not advice! Good luck!
